Valvoline Inc. is a leader in automotive preventive maintenance delivering convenient and trusted services in its retail stores throughout the United States (‘U.S.’) and Canada.
Valvoline and the company’s franchise partners keep customers moving with approximately 15-minute stay-in-your-car oil changes; battery, bulb and wiper replacements; tire rotations; and other manufacturer recommended maintenance services. The company operates and franchises more than 2,000 service center locations through its Valvoline Instant Oil Change (‘VIOC’) and Valvoline Great Canadian Oil Change (‘GCOC’) retail locations and supports nearly 270 locations through its Express Care platform.
Discontinued Operations
On March 1, 2023, Valvoline completed the sale of its former Global Products reportable segment (doing business as ‘Valvoline Global Operations’ and referred to herein as ‘Global Products’) to Aramco Overseas Company B.V.
Valvoline’s Retail Services
Valvoline operates and franchises more than 2,000 service center locations through its VIOC and GCOC retail locations and supports nearly 270 locations through its Express Care platform. The company has built a reputation as the quick, easy, trusted name in automotive preventive maintenance through its full-service oil changes from certified technicians in approximately 15-minutes, including a free 18-point maintenance check. Valvoline continues to build its market share by leveraging its stay-in-your-car service model and providing each customer with service that can be seen by experts they can trust. Valvoline technicians utilize the company’s proprietary SuperPro system to deliver a superior customer experience and make timely service recommendations based upon visual inspection, vehicle service history, and original equipment manufacturer (‘OEM’) recommendations. The SuperPro system is utilized in both company-operated and franchised service center locations, creating a consistent service experience for customers.

Retail Store Development
Valvoline utilizes a three-pronged approach to grow its retail network through 1) franchisee store expansion 2) opportunistic acquisitions, and 3) new store development.
Competition
Valvoline’s retail stores compete for consumers and franchisees with other major franchised brands that offer a turn-key operations management system, such as Jiffy Lube, Grease Monkey, Take 5 Oil Change, Express Oil Change, and Mr. Lube in Canada.

Intellectual Property
Valvoline holds approximately 390 trademarks in more than 70 countries across the world, including the Valvoline and ‘V’ brand logo trademarks. These trademarks have a perpetual life, are generally subject to renewal every ten years, and are among Valvoline's most protected and valuable assets. With the completion of the sale of Global Products, Valvoline owns the Valvoline brand for all global retail services, excluding China and certain countries in the Middle East and North Africa, while Global Products owns the Valvoline brand for all product uses globally. Valvoline partners with Global Products to ensure that Valvoline's iconic brand is managed in a consistent and holistic manner.
Valvoline trade names and service marks used in its business include Valvoline and Valvoline Instant Oil Change, among others. Valvoline is also party to arrangements that license its intellectual property to others in return for revenues. Valvoline owns approximately 700 domain names that are used to promote Valvoline services and provide information about the company.
Seasonality
Valvoline’s business is moderately impacted by seasonality. Transaction volumes follow driving patterns of consumers, which generally trend with the length of daylight hours, North American holidays, and vacation timing. As a result, the second half of the fiscal year (year ended September 2024) ordinarily is more robust as miles driven tends to be higher.
Regulatory and Environmental Matters
Valvoline is subject to numerous federal, state, local and non-U.S. environmental laws including the Comprehensive Environmental Response Compensation and Liability Act.
As a franchisor, Valvoline is subject to various federal, state, and non-U.S. franchising laws.
The company is also subject to labor and employment laws, including regulations established by the U.S. Department of Labor and other local regulatory agencies, governing working conditions, paid leave, workplace safety, wage and hour standards, and hiring and employment practices.
History
Valvoline Inc. was founded in 1866. The company was incorporated in 2016.
